Nahara Gram Panchayat, Bhograi
Nahara is a Gram Panchayat located in the Balasore district of Odisha. It falls under the Bhograi Panchayat Samiti and Balasore Zila Parishad. Nahara Gram Panchayat covers a total of 11 villages, including Badamandaruni, Balikira, and Chaksalim. It is headed by an elected Sarpanch, while administrative work is handled by the Panchayat Secretary.
List of Villages in Nahara Gram Panchayat
Nahara Gram Panchayat covers the following villages.
| Sl. No. | Village |
|---|---|
| 1 | Badamandaruni |
| 2 | Balikira |
| 3 | Chaksalim |
| 4 | Kanhupur |
| 5 | Kasimila |
| 6 | Masanbaria |
| 7 | Mundamari |
| 8 | Nahara |
| 9 | Rautmandaruni |
| 10 | Relapata |
| 11 | Saentpata |
Panchayati Raj Structure for Nahara Gram Panchayat
Nahara Gram Panchayat is part of Odisha's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.
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)
Nahara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.
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)
Bhograi Panchayat Samiti is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Nahara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.
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)
Balasore Zila Parishad is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Nahara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
